A collinear array antenna is an antenna array composed of two or more antenna units (such as half-wave dipoles) arranged along the same straight line or axis. These antenna units can achieve higher gain, narrower beam width and lower side lobe level than a single antenna through mutual coupling and collaboration, thereby forming a more concentrated radiation or reception capability in a specific direction. Collinear array antennas are widely used in communication, radar, navigation, satellite communication and other fields. In communication systems, colinear array antennas can be used to improve the coverage and signal quality of base station antennas; in radar systems, they can be used to improve the detection distance and resolution of radars; in satellite communications, colinear array antennas help achieve more efficient signal transmission and reception.
